Kriti Sanon Plays A Tomboy In Bareilly Ki Barfi, Says She Is Attracted To Quirky Characters!

The actress says that her role in the film is completely opposite of who she is in real life.

Kriti Sanon recently wrapped up the shooting schedule of her upcoming film Bareilly Ki Barfi which has her sharing screen space with Ayushmann Khurrana and Rajkummar Rao. The pretty actress spoke about her role in the film to a leading lady and revealed why she gave her nod to this film.

Kriti was quoted saying, "It was a tough role to shoot as I play a tomoboyish character and had to talk in the Uttar Pradesh lingo. Rohit Choudhury, who is also in the film and from Lucknow taught us all the intonations, pauses and how to pitch the dialogues. My role is of a deglamourized tomboy who wears denims, kurtas, half jackets and loose pullovers."

She further added, "I had to incorporate little things into the character and think how else to make her a little more different. She works in the electricity department and takes in all the complaints so she's quite independent and strong-headed and questions a lot of things. What attracted to me the role was that it's not just unique, fun and special but the way it is written - it keeps you entertained throughout with the humour and romance. It's something I have never done before and I get attracted to quirky characters. My role is completely opposite to who I am."

Talking about her other films, Kriti will be next seen in Sushant Singh Rajput's Raabta which is slated to release in June 2017. Meanwhile, she opted out of Farhan Akhtar's Lucknow Central citing date issues and if one goes by the latest buzz then Mirzya girl Saiyami Kher is now likely to step into her shoes.
